MONROE, OHIO — IDI Gazeley has unveiled plans to develop Park North at Monroe Building 10, a 755,911-square-foot warehouse facility in Monroe, about 30 miles north of Cincinnati. Building 10 will be the largest 36-foot-clear-height availability in greater Cincinnati, according to CBRE. The facility is slated for completion in the fourth quarter of 2017. Jeremy Kraus of CBRE is marketing the building for lease. Park North at Monroe is a master-planned park located between Cincinnati and Dayton, with access to I-75. Tenants within the park include Home Depot, Cornerstone Brands and Hayneedle.

LITTLE FERRY, N.J. — Marcus & Millichap has arranged the sale of an industrial property located at 100-120 Industrial Ave. in Little Ferry. A private investor sold the property for $7 million. Robert Filley, Steve Mariani and Daniel Farley of Marcus & Millichap represented the seller in the transaction. The name of the buyer was not released.

GARLAND, TEXAS — Marcus & Millichap has negotiated the sale of a 54,000-square-foot industrial property at 3605 Security St., near the intersection of South Jupiter and West Miller roads in Garland, a northeastern suburb of Dallas. The property, leased to Andreola Terrazzo & Restoration, a stone restoration company, underwent roughly $450,000 of renovations in 2015. Adam Abushagur of Marcus & Millichap represented the seller and procured the buyer, both of whom are private investors.

MIAMI, ORLANDO AND JACKSONVILLE, FLA. — Atlanta-based MDH Partners LLC has purchased a portfolio of 23 distribution buildings in Florida totaling more than 3.3 million square feet. The Class A and B properties are located in Miami, Orlando and Jacksonville. The sales price was undisclosed. Hank Hall and Kevin Troy of Colliers International’s Atlanta office arranged $134 million in acquisition financing through Bank of America, Wells Fargo and Synovus Bank on behalf of MDH. Since May 2014, the company has purchased or developed 93 industrial properties totaling more than 11.7 million square feet. MDH’s other assets are located in Atlanta, Memphis, Tampa, Charlotte, Raleigh, Greenville, Winston-Salem, Norfolk and Richmond.

TEMPE, ARIZ. — Carter Validus Mission Critical REIT II has purchased the 44,244-square-foot Tempe Data Center for $16.2 million. The facility is situated near Phoenix Sky Harbor International Airport, downtown Phoenix and downtown Tempe. The facility has been fully leased to a national provider of wireless voice, messaging and data services since 1997. It underwent remodeling in 1983, 2008 and 2011. The center features 15,000 square feet of white space, 8,711 square feet of office space and 20,533 square feet of warehouse space, including a 4,355-square-foot mezzanine level. CBRE’S Luke Denmon and Mindy Korth and Kirk Kuller of Colliers International represented the seller, El Dorado Holdings, in this transaction.

TUALATIN, ORE. — Superwinch has leased 38,812 square feet of factory space at Koch Corporate Center in Tualatin. The industrial park is situated at SW 115th Avenue and Tualatin-Sherwood Road. The designer, manufacturer and marketer of winch systems and accessories is building a design and manufacturing facility to complement existing facilities in Connecticut and the United Kingdom. The new facility will become Superwinch’s corporate headquarters. It will include both assembly and distribution of new product abilities. The new facility is scheduled for completion this April, with Superwinch taking occupancy the following month. CBRE’s Cara Nolan represented Superwinch. The landlord is PacTrust.

SEATTLE — Terreno Realty Corp. has acquired a 45,000-square-foot industrial distribution building in Seattle for $7.8 million. The facility is located at 637 S. Lucile St. It sits adjacent to the city’s Port and SoDo (south of Downtown) districts. The asset is fully leased to one tenant on a short-term basis.

KATY, TEXAS — TMEIC Power Electronics Products Corp., a Tokyo-based partnership between Toshiba and Mitsubishi, has broken ground on a 45,000-square-foot industrial facility in Katy, a western suburb of Houston. Lone Star Construction is the general contractor for the facility, which is expected to open later this year. Roughly $6 million in capital expenditures has been earmarked for the project. Located off Grand Parkway in Energy Park West Business Park, the property will serve as a center of assembly, testing and packaging of photovoltaic inverters for the solar power market.

BILLERICA AND MARLBOROUGH, MASS. — The RAM Cos. has acquired two industrial and flex buildings, located at 35 Dunham Road in Billerica and 734 Forest St. in Marlborough, for $10.1 million. The Billerica property offers 65,912 square feet of space and is located within Middlesex Corporate Park. Tark Inc., SciSafe and Microchips Biotech are tenants at the property. Situated within Cedar Hill Business Park, the Marlborough property features 54,884 square feet of industrial space. At the time of sale, the property was fully leased to a variety of tenants, including CeQur Corp., Sunrun, Chroma Systems Solutions and Commonwealth Financial Network. The name of the seller was not released.

RIDGEFIELD, N.J. — KW International has signed a long-term lease for an industrial building located at 2 Bell Drive in Ridgefield. The Carson, Calif.-based company will occupy the entire 83,000-square-foot speculative building. Mike Markey, Jon Tesser and Reid Wilbraham of Colliers International represented the tenant, while Stephen Elman of Cushman & Wakefield represented the landlord, Sitex Group, in the deal.
